11.1 Temperature and Thermal Energy - Physics OpenStax

WebThe total internal energy of a system is the sum of the kinetic and potential energies of its atoms and molecules. Thermal energy is one of the subcategories of internal energy, as is chemical energy. To measure temperature, some scale must be used as a standard of measurement. The three most commonly used temperature scales are the Fahrenheit ... WebEnergy stored in fields within a system can also be described as potential energy. For any system where the stored energy depends only on the spatial configuration of the system and not on its history, potential energy is a useful concept (e.g., a massive object above Earth’s surface, a compressed or stretched spring). WebA potential energy surface ( PES) describes the energy of a system, especially a collection of atoms, in terms of certain parameters, normally the positions of the atoms. The surface might define the energy as a function of one or more coordinates; if there is only one coordinate, the surface is called a potential energy curve or energy profile. WebNov 8, 2024 · The derivative of a function f (x), d f d x, at some values of x represents the slope of the f (x) vs x plot at the particular values of x. Thus, graphically Equation 2.7.1 means that if we have potential energy vs. position plot, the force is the negative of the slope of the function at some point: (2.7.2) F = − ( s l o p e)
